Astronaut Shubhanshu Shukla is set to engage with students and ISRO engineers through a unique radio communication event, sparking excitement and inspiration within the scientific community. This initiative highlights the importance of direct interaction between accomplished astronauts and the next generation of aspiring scientists and engineers. Shukla, who has gained recognition for his contributions to space exploration, aims to share his experiences and insights, providing a rare opportunity for participants to learn from someone who has journeyed into space.
The event will not only allow students to ask questions about space travel, but it will also serve as a platform for ISRO engineers to discuss the technical aspects of space missions.
